10 Features Of A High Quality Doctoral Thesis In World Literature

Your doctoral thesis is one of your most important works. It is a paper that will likely take you months to write, and that could make or break your final grade. As you begin to work on this important document, consider the ten features your paper needs to include.

  1. It demonstrates your knowledge.
  2. This paper caps off your doctoral curriculum. It is imperative that it demonstrates your knowledge of world literature as a whole as well as your knowledge on the particular subject about which you’re writing. Take the time to examine all the literary works that should have impact on your paper, so that you don’t leave out any important works.

  3. It is well researched.
  4. Researching your paper will likely be the most time consuming part of the process. Use multiple reliable sources to ensure your case is well supported.

  5. Resources are properly cited.
  6. A doctoral paper must contain a bibliography, and all sources must be properly cited.

  7. It has a main point.
  8. Before you begin, write your thesis statement. This is a simple statement of the overall point your paper sets out to make, and will guide the rest of your writing. All paths your paper takes must lead to this original point. Writing this part first will help you stay on track.

  9. It is well organized.
  10. You will have many different sections in your paper, each with a distinct point. Organize these points so that the paper reads logically.

  11. It is well written.
  12. Write concisely and authoritatively. Avoid the passive voice and be certain to avoid slang. Remember that academic writing should be easy to read but somewhat formal.

  13. It contains no spelling or grammatical errors.
  14. If proper spelling and grammar don’t come naturally to you, find someone to edit your work. Papers at this level of academia must be error free.

  15. It is unique.
  16. It’s important to write from a unique perspective so that your thesis doesn’t sound just like another. You may choose a subject that has been written about regularly, but if so, choose a new spin on the subject.

  17. It is original.
  18. It should go without saying, but plagiarism is not tolerated at this level of academic writing. Use a plagiarism website to check your work, if needed.

  19. It follows the guidelines.
  20. Be certain to follow your professor’s requirements to the letter when writing your paper. Failure to adhere to the rubric can cost you a significant number of points on your final grade.

Your thesis is an exciting time in finishing your academic career. Take care to ensure your paper meets these ten guidelines to have a thesis paper you’ll be happy to publish.
